    • Self-learning methodology in simulated environments (MAES©) as a learning tool in perioperative nursing. An evidence-based practice model for acquiring clinical safety competencies 

      Peñataro-Pintado, Ester; Díaz-Agea, José Luis; Castillo, Isabel; Leal-Costa, César; Ramos-Morcillo, Antonio Jesús; Ruzafa-Martínez, María; Rodríguez-Higueras, Encarna (International Journal of Environmental Research and Public Health, 2021)
      Background: The self-learning Methodology in Simulated Environments (Spanish acronym: MAES©, (Murcia, Spain) is a type of self-directed and collaborative training in health sciences. The objective of ...
